Thank you for joining us for what turned out to be a fantastic Korean Grand Prix. Make sure you keep checking the site for all the reaction from teams and drivers.

Lap 55

Alonso wins the Korean Grand Prix to lead the championship.

Hamilton is second and Massa finishes third. Schumacher should come through for fourth, Kubica fifth and a good result for Liuzzi in sixth.

Alonso stands on top of his Ferrari, arms aloft and faces a bank of flash bulbs.

Alonso starts the final lap in near darkness. Hamilton is 12.3 seconds adrift.

The rear end of the Ferrari is still kicking out on throttle application, so he's not taking it that easily.

Lap 54

It's getting very, very dark with just two laps to go.

Hamilton is now 10 seconds off Alonso but has a 17.5 second gap to Massa.

Alguersuari makes a mistake and now has Hulkenberg closing behind him.

Lap 53

Hamilton has dropped back to 5.4 seconds off Alonso, his tyres may well be on the edge.

Barrichello has made two mistakes on worn tyres and lost two places to Kubcia and Liuzzi.

Lap 52

Alonso is now 3.6 seconds clear of Hamilton.

Hulkenberg has pitted for another set of intermediates, Kubica is up to fifth.

Button has a half spin on worn tyres but keeps it out of the barrier.

Lap 51

Kubica is now closing on Hulkenberg. There are a lot of bald intermediate tyres out there now. Five laps remaining.

Alonso was 2.8 seconds clear of Hamilton as they crossed the line.

Massa very nearly lost it at the same point as Webber but held it all together.
